武夷山常绿阔叶林结构与功能的特征研究进展

摘    要:围绕武夷山群落结构特征、主要生态功能以及与其他区域常绿阔叶林的比较进行研究表明:①对武夷山常绿阔叶林的群落特征调查主要集中在米槠林、甜槠林、丝栗栲林、青冈林和木荷林等5种森林群落类型,其中关于甜槠林群落结构特征的报道较多;②有关武夷山常绿阔叶林生态功能的研究主要集中在土壤特征和群落特征调查方面,在土壤特征调查方面主要研究了土壤的生化和理化性质,在群落调查方面主要回答了物种组成、多样性分析、种间联结性、生物量等问题,土壤和群落特征调查方面发表的文献占文献总数量的90%以上,而气候和水文方面的报道较少。

The research progress on the structure and function characterilstics of evergreen broad-leaved forest of Wuyi Mountain

Abstract:Based on the study of the community characteristics,main ecological function of Wuyi Mountain,then compared with the evergreen broad-leaved forests in other regions,the results indicated: ①the target of investigation on the community characteristics of evergreen broad-leaved forests in Wuyi Mountain focused on the five forest community types of Castanopsis carlesii,Castanopsis eyrei,Castanopsis fargesii,Fagus longipetiolata and Schima superba.Especially,the report of C.s eyrei community structure was the most;②the research on ecological function of the evergreen broad-leaved forests in Wuyi Mountain focused mainly on soil characteristic and community structure.The research on biochemistry,physics and chemistry of soil characteristics was emphasized,and the problems of species composition,diversity analyzing,interspecies correlation,biomass were solved.The documentaries which have published about soil characteristic and community structure were more than 90% of the total,nevertheless,the documentaries on climate and hydrology were less.
